华为鸿蒙系统:图片马赛克技术的深入解析274
简介华为鸿蒙系统是一款面向万物互联时代开发的操作系统,在图像处理方面拥有出色的表现。图片马赛克技术是鸿蒙系统中一项重要的图像处理功能,它可以将图像中的像素点重新排列,形成马赛克图案,从而达到模糊图像内容的目的。
技术原理图片马赛克技术的原理是将图像中的像素点划分为一个个小方块,然后对每个方块内的像素点进行平均取样。平均后的颜色值代表了该方块内的主色调。将所有方块的主色调组合在一起,就形成了马赛克图案。
方块的大小直接影响马赛克图案的精细程度。方块越大,马赛克图案越模糊;方块越小,马赛克图案越清晰。鸿蒙系统提供了灵活的方块大小调节功能,用户可以根据需要选择合适的方块大小。
算法优化为了提高图片马赛克技术的效率和准确性,鸿蒙系统采用了多种算法优化措施:
快速平均算法:采用加权平均算法,有效减少计算量,提高平均效率。
边缘检测算法:自动检测图像中的边缘,并沿边缘进行更精细的马赛克处理,增强图像的层次感。
色彩空间转换:将图像从 RGB 色彩空间转换为 HSV 色彩空间,分离开明度、饱和度和色相信息,并针对不同信息进行马赛克处理,提升色彩精度。
应用场景图片马赛克技术在鸿蒙系统中有着广泛的应用场景,例如:
隐私保护:模糊敏感信息或人脸,保护用户隐私。
图像美化:通过马赛克效果,实现复古怀旧或艺术化的图像效果。
图像加密:结合其他加密算法,对图像进行马赛克处理,提高图像安全性。
图像拼图:将马赛克图案作为图像拼图的线索,提升拼图的趣味性和挑战性。
优势与传统的马赛克技术相比,鸿蒙系统图片马赛克技术具有以下优势:
效率高:优化算法显著提升了马赛克处理效率,即使处理高分辨率图像也能流畅运行。
准确性强:边缘检测和色彩空间转换算法确保了马赛克图案的准确性和清晰度。
灵活性高:用户可自定义方块大小和算法参数,实现个性化马赛克效果。
安全性强:可与加密算法结合使用,提升图像安全性,保护敏感信息。
总结华为鸿蒙系统图片马赛克技术是一种高效、准确、灵活、安全的图像处理技术。它基于先进的算法优化,在隐私保护、图像美化、图像加密等应用场景中发挥着重要作用。随着鸿蒙系统的进一步发展,图片马赛克技术也将不断升级,为用户提供更加丰富和实用的图像处理功能。
2024-10-27
新文章

Android系统文件权限修改详解:风险、方法与安全策略

Windows系统功能启用详解及潜在风险

Linux系统自动启动详解:服务、守护进程与系统启动流程

Android系统图像旋转与裁剪:深入底层机制与优化策略

Windows过期密钥:深入解析失效机制及应对策略

Android Input Subsystem 深入解析:驱动、架构及事件处理

Android系统相机调用与图像剪裁的底层机制

Linux内核与Android系统的深度融合:架构、驱动及性能优化

华为鸿蒙HarmonyOS深度技术解析:架构、特性与创新

iOS与Flyme系统深度比较:架构、特性与差异
热门文章

iOS 系统的局限性

Mac OS 9:革命性操作系统的深度剖析

macOS 直接安装新系统,保留原有数据

Linux USB 设备文件系统

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

iOS 操作系统:移动领域的先驱

华为鸿蒙系统:全面赋能多场景智慧体验
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]
